The Mother of God Peribleptos |
14th century 87 x 68.5 cm. Tempera. Plaster ground on board. From the church of the Mother of God Peribleptos (St. Clement’s), Ohrid. Today - Church of the Mother of God Peribleptos, Ohrid. |
| Condition: Very well preserved. Iconography: The Mother of God Peribleptos, portrayed in half-length with little Christ in her arm. She is dressed in a dark-red maphorion decorated with gold bands. She points with her right hand to Christ. The infant Christ is dressed in a olive-green himation striped with gold. He gives a blessing with His left hand and in His right he holds a scroll. Conservation: Cleaned in the Conservation laboratory of IPCM - Skopje.
